    Highly acclaimed 1976 television adaptation of one of George Bernard Shaw's best-loved works starring Alec Guinness as Julius Caesar and Genevieve Bujold as Cleopatra. On campaign in Egypt and aging Julius Caesar becomes captivated by the beautiful young and capricious Cleopatra. Caesar promises to turn the young girl in to a Queen fit for Egypt - tutoring her in the ways of power. But Egypt is not Rome and although Caesar can conquer the country can he tame her future queen? A truly outstanding performance from Alec Guinness as the ultimately tragic Caesar and a sensuous complex performance form Genevieve Bujold which rivals and other screen portrayal of Cleopatra.

    With fierce originality, this powerful adaptation of the Sophocles tragedy presents a world of honour, treachery and fateful consequences. Acclaimed actress, Genevieve Bujold, skilfully combines elements of zealotry and idealism in her affecting portrait of Antigone. Jean Anouilh's retelling of Antigone stages the inescapably wrenching, central confrontation between Antigone and Creon by presenting Miss Bujold and Mr. Weaver seated at a long, executive-suite table - a hallmark of Anouilh's play. The New York Times critic, John J. O'Connor, lauded this Antigone as well acted, well directed and beautifully staged.

    Recently released from prison after serving an eight-year stretch for killing a mob boss ex-cop Hawk (Kristofferson) returns to his native home of Rain City and takes up residence in a room at the back of the caf'' owned and run by his former lover Wanda (Bujold). At the same time a beautiful waif-like young woman Georgia (Singer) her sociopathic boyfriend Coop (Carradine) and their new-born child also arrive in their trailer and make the caf'''s parking lot their temporary home. Desperately in need of money Georgia takes on a waitressing job at Wanda's place while Coop slowly but surely is lured into a life of petty crime. Already a regular customer at the caf'' Hawk soon falls under Georgia's spell and sets out to seduce her during the lonely nights that Coop is not around. Meanwhile Coop's criminal activities have attracted the attention of gangland boss Hilly Blue (Divine) a ruthless crimelord whose method of dealing with freelance crooks operating on his turf extends to drowning them in their cars. When Coop's life is threatened by Hilly and his men Hawk finds himself in a position where he must decide to put his own life on line by helping him or risk losing the woman he most desires. Humorously and stylistically employing the classic film noir themes of crime responsibility loyalty and love Rudolph's film presents a refreshingly original take on the genre one that is brilliantly enhanced by composer Mark Isham's (In The Valley Of Elah; The Black Dahlia; Crash) superbly evocative score.
